05-28-2020, 06:02 PM
(Modification du message : 05-28-2020, 06:27 PM par Processeur fou.)
Ouh là là, il y a beaucoup d'objets de réflexion dans tout ça.
Tout d'abord il faudrait qu'on se mette d'accord sur ce que vous appelez un DAC
Pour moi (électronicien/informaticien) un DAC est avant tout un chip qui converti des valeurs binaires en une tension, pour notre cas un signal PCM en un siganl audio analogique. Si on ne rajoute pas un processeur, FPGA ou chip spécialisé, un DAC ne pourra jamais décoder un fichier FLAC.
Donc si certains DAC du marché mangent du FLAC, c'est qu'il n'y a pas qu'un process DAC à l'intérieur mais aussi un ensemble plus complexe. Pour l'instant les schémas de DAC ou carte son que j'ai eu sous la main n'ont jamais eu un chip capable de décompresser du FLAC.
Donc dans l'usage d'un DAC USB, c'est l'appli qui lit le FLAC qui le décompresse et envoie du PCM dans l'USB.
mais si ce qu'on utilise comme DAC USB relié à son PC est un RaspberryPi avec un chip DAC , alors oui on pourrait envoyer par l'USB les data FLAC et
Quand Muscar écrit "Ce FLAC est parfaitement traitable par un DAC en USB" je dirai "parce que le MAC le converti en PCM le fichier FLAC avant de l'envoyer en USB" ou alors ce que Musca appelle un DAC ici n'est plus seulement un DAC mais peut fairedu traitement en plus de la conversion digitale/analogique.
donc je suisd'accord avec ce que dit notre ami:
"Je croyais avoir compris que les DAC recevaient obligatoirement un fichier PCM décompressé par les logiciels utilisés pour la lecture"
oui forcément sinon ce n'est plus un DAC mais un boitier plus complexe avec du traitement informatique.
Donc tout dépend de ce qu'on appelle un DAC. ( = Digital Analog Converter et rien d'autre)
Ce que vous appelez un "DAC USB" est peut-être le cas où on a rajouté un chip de traitement décodage etc... Je ne me suis jamais penché sur ce que c'est qu'un "DAC USB" à part que c'est une électroniique capable de recevoir un flux de data par USB au lieu de SPDIF/AES/EBU. Alors cette adjonction d'entrée USB peut être faite par des chips USB comme il y a sur les cartes son USB évoluées (MOTU, Focusrite,AVID ..) où le chip USB fait le transfert vers le chip DAC. mais pas encore vu de matériel ayant de quoi traiter du FLAC, donc avec processeur, soft etc.
Donc éclairez mon ignorance:
- un DAC est un DAC, comme ceux que je connais avec entrée SPDIF ou AES/EBU et ça ne mange que des data décompréssées.
- un "DAC USB" ne serait pas simplement un DAC avec entrée USB mais serait un "boîtier" avec processeur/traitement, software/firmare paramétrable pour faire de la décompression de FLAC (entre autres) et ensuite envoyer les data décompressées à un DAC
concernant WASAPI, oui, à ne pas utiliser si possible.
pour mon cas comme c'est le transporter qui bosse , la question ne se pose pas.
mais pour les captures par SPDIF dans mes essais j'utilisais les drivers ASIO
merci n.d.b. pour avoir bien fait un résumé en différents points... très clair.
Ah! Je viens de relire , "DAC USB" ne serait plutôt ce que tu as nommé à un moment "Lecteur/DAC", dans ce cas le terme est plsu clair
reste à finir de cogiter
Tout d'abord il faudrait qu'on se mette d'accord sur ce que vous appelez un DAC
Pour moi (électronicien/informaticien) un DAC est avant tout un chip qui converti des valeurs binaires en une tension, pour notre cas un signal PCM en un siganl audio analogique. Si on ne rajoute pas un processeur, FPGA ou chip spécialisé, un DAC ne pourra jamais décoder un fichier FLAC.
Donc si certains DAC du marché mangent du FLAC, c'est qu'il n'y a pas qu'un process DAC à l'intérieur mais aussi un ensemble plus complexe. Pour l'instant les schémas de DAC ou carte son que j'ai eu sous la main n'ont jamais eu un chip capable de décompresser du FLAC.
Donc dans l'usage d'un DAC USB, c'est l'appli qui lit le FLAC qui le décompresse et envoie du PCM dans l'USB.
mais si ce qu'on utilise comme DAC USB relié à son PC est un RaspberryPi avec un chip DAC , alors oui on pourrait envoyer par l'USB les data FLAC et
Quand Muscar écrit "Ce FLAC est parfaitement traitable par un DAC en USB" je dirai "parce que le MAC le converti en PCM le fichier FLAC avant de l'envoyer en USB" ou alors ce que Musca appelle un DAC ici n'est plus seulement un DAC mais peut fairedu traitement en plus de la conversion digitale/analogique.
donc je suisd'accord avec ce que dit notre ami:
"Je croyais avoir compris que les DAC recevaient obligatoirement un fichier PCM décompressé par les logiciels utilisés pour la lecture"
oui forcément sinon ce n'est plus un DAC mais un boitier plus complexe avec du traitement informatique.
Donc tout dépend de ce qu'on appelle un DAC. ( = Digital Analog Converter et rien d'autre)
Ce que vous appelez un "DAC USB" est peut-être le cas où on a rajouté un chip de traitement décodage etc... Je ne me suis jamais penché sur ce que c'est qu'un "DAC USB" à part que c'est une électroniique capable de recevoir un flux de data par USB au lieu de SPDIF/AES/EBU. Alors cette adjonction d'entrée USB peut être faite par des chips USB comme il y a sur les cartes son USB évoluées (MOTU, Focusrite,AVID ..) où le chip USB fait le transfert vers le chip DAC. mais pas encore vu de matériel ayant de quoi traiter du FLAC, donc avec processeur, soft etc.
Donc éclairez mon ignorance:
- un DAC est un DAC, comme ceux que je connais avec entrée SPDIF ou AES/EBU et ça ne mange que des data décompréssées.
- un "DAC USB" ne serait pas simplement un DAC avec entrée USB mais serait un "boîtier" avec processeur/traitement, software/firmare paramétrable pour faire de la décompression de FLAC (entre autres) et ensuite envoyer les data décompressées à un DAC
concernant WASAPI, oui, à ne pas utiliser si possible.
pour mon cas comme c'est le transporter qui bosse , la question ne se pose pas.
mais pour les captures par SPDIF dans mes essais j'utilisais les drivers ASIO
merci n.d.b. pour avoir bien fait un résumé en différents points... très clair.
Ah! Je viens de relire , "DAC USB" ne serait plutôt ce que tu as nommé à un moment "Lecteur/DAC", dans ce cas le terme est plsu clair
reste à finir de cogiter